BOYS SOCCER

FAIRFIELD 2, LOVELAND 2: Troy Wintermeyer and T.J. Newbright scored goals as the Indians recorded a tie in a nonleague matchup on Tuesday, Sept. 7. Fairfield is 0-4-1.

GIRLS SOCCER

BADIN 4, DAYTON CHAMINADE JULIENNE 1: Allie Crossley scored two goals, Lauren Mathews had a goal and two assists and Hannah Wimmers had a goal and an assist for the Rams on Wednesday, Sept. 8. Kim Golden also scored for Badin (2-1), and Abby Stapf, Ashley Mahoney and Morgan Pater also played well for the Rams.

ROSS 3, EDGEWOOD 1: Allie Higgins, Megan Strickland and Taylor Ahrens scored for the Rams (4-2, 2-0 Fort Ancient Valley Conference), who rallied from a 1-0 deficit in the second half on Wednesday. Anna Hall and Amanda Hagedorn had assists, and Nickki Hall recorded seven goal saves. Also playing well for Ross were Amanda McDonald, Sami Foley and Peyton Webster. Bree Williams scored for the Cougars (4-1, 1-1 FAVC) and Brooke Haynes had the assist. The contest was scoreless at halftime.

MOUNT NOTRE DAME 1, FAIRFIELD 0: The Indians (4-2) were led on offense by Julia Wood and Macy Hamblin and on defense by Hayley Swain.

EDGEWOOD 1, VALLEY VIEW 0: Maddie Slusher scored off an assist from Miranda Wright to lift the Cougars past the Spartans on Tuesday night, Sept. 7. EHS improved to 4-0-0 and Valley View fell to 2-3-1.

BOYS GOLF

HAMILTON 171, HARRISON 182: The medalist was Hamilton’s Nick Spurlock, who shot 38 at Twin Run Golf Course on Wednesday, Sept. 8. Teammate Chris Lindsey shot 43 and Steven Moore added a 44 for the Big Blue (5-8).

BADIN WINS TRI-MATCH: The Rams finished first on Wednesday at Kenwood Country Club with a score of 170, followed by Madeira, 172, and Wyoming, 173. The medalist for the sixth time this season was Badin’s Austin Sandor with a 1-over-par 36. Tyler Hammerle shot 41 for the Rams, who improved to 17-5-1. Wyoming is 15-5 and Madeira stands 8-10.

LAKOTA WEST 148, SYCAMORE 164: Korey Ward was the medalist with a 2-under-par 34 for the Firebirds (4-4) in Wednesday’s dual-meet at Glenview Golf Course. Jared Schroeder shot 37 for West, followed by teammates Marshall Stretch, 38, and Jeff Ray, 39.

EDGEWOOD 188, PREBLE SHAWNEE 237: Edgewood’s Cody Marcum and Cameron Williams each shot 46 to share medalist honors as the Cougars defeated Preble Shawnee on Wednesday, Sept. 8 at Weatherwax Golf Course. Matt Deaton shot 48 to lead the Arrows.

GIRLS VOLLEYBALL

FAIRFIELD 3, MONROE 0: The Indians defeated the Hornets 25-13, 25-16, 25-10 on Wednesday, Sept. 8. Leading players for the Indians were Karsen Cronin, 17 kills, four aces and 10 digs; Justine Kaminsky, 22 assists and two aces; Kynesha Pitts, four kills and a block; and Jamie Hoskinson, four aces and eight digs. Fairfield improved to 1-1. Monroe slipped to 2-4.

HARRISON 3, EDGEWOOD 0: Harrison won 25-14, 26-24, 26-24 in a match played on Tuesday, Sept. 7. Leading players for the Cougars (3-5 overall, 1-2 in the Fort Ancient Valley Conference) were Erin Sharp, six blocks, and Kathryn Voel and Amanda Hobbs, strong serving.
